(The Center Square) – Florida and Texas have gained the most by interstate migration, while California, Illinois, and New York have lost the most, according to a new analysis, with the report’s author saying such shifts are due to tax policies: “Americans seek greener pastures.”
The National Taxpayers Union Foundation report revealed that “California, New York, Illinois, and other states with high tax burdens continue to hemorrhage taxpayers and tax revenue, while Florida remains the undeniable winner from movement of taxpayers and their dollars from state to state.”
